Lead workshop, refurbishment and stores activity at a major UK manufacturing site We are recruiting for an experienced Workshop Lead to join a major chemical / process manufacturing site in Greatham.The plant is entering an exciting new stage, with renewed focus on engineering support, equipment reliability, spares availability, refurbishment quality and safe production .This is a key leadership role where you will lead the onsite workshop, equipment refurbishment team and equipment/materials stores facilities.What youll be doing You will:Lead onsite workshop, repair and refurbishment activity.Oversee off-plant equipment overhauls and refurbishments.Ensure repair priorities align with plant operational needs.Maintain quality assurance and quality control standards for workshop repairs.Promote a right-first-time approach to repair and refurbishment work.Manage external service providers and outsourced overhaul activity.Track offsite refurbishments, including cost, quality, delivery and operational impact.Lead onsite stores, consumables, replacement equipment and critical spares.Oversee work order kitting to support efficient maintenance delivery.Manage workshop and stores resources, budgets, strategy and team performance.Support Management of Change requirements linked to materials, equipment or technical specifications.What were looking for You will need:A degree in an engineering discipline, or equivalent engineering / manufacturing experience.8+ years industrial experience in manufacturing, engineering or maintenance.Experience leading workshop, maintenance, refurbishment, stores, repair or engineering support teams.Experience managing equipment overhaul, refurbishment or repair activity.Understanding of quality assurance and control in an engineering or maintenance environment.Experience working with external service providers, suppliers or outsourced engineering services.Strong resource, budget and performance management capability.The ability to lead, motivate, performance manage and develop team members.A clear commitment to safe working, compliance, continuous improvement and high engineering standards.Useful experience It would be beneficial if you have experience of:Chemical, process, high-hazard or Upper Tier COMAH manufacturing environments.Managing onsite stores, spares, consumables or engineering materials.Overseeing work order kitting processes.Controlling offsite refurbishments or outsourced overhauls.Developing workshop, stores, maintenance or E&I strategies.Applying Management of Change to materials, equipment or technical specification changes.Working with purchasing teams to support spares availability and supplier performance.Identifying equipment improvement opportunities with engineering teams.Why apply?
